I've noticed that a lot of games have been redone and become more successful the second time around, but there seem to be a few games that had to be reworked twice to become successful.

This geeklist is intended to honor those games, game mechanics, designers, and publishers that were most successful on their third attempt.

A lot of these are probably wargames as it might be more difficult to get a historical simulation correct. Furthermore, some older wargames may have had more time to be reworked.

I'm sure that there are probably some role-playing game and video game examples too.

There is a Third Edition of "Napoleon: The Waterloo Campaign, 1815" in the database ranked lower than the First Edition. This may partially be due that fact that the original game was split out in the database with certain wargamers perhaps never ranking the other version.

However, let's look at the history of Columbia's block games instead:

Quebec 1759 (1972)
-- 1st Columbia block game
Number of User Rankings 433
Ranked 865

War of 1812 (1973)
-- 2nd Columbia block game
Number of User Rankings 417
Ranked 823

Napoleon: The Waterloo Campaign, 1815 (1974)
-- 3rd Columbia block game
Number of User Rankings 625
Ranked 439

I've seen and played all 3 editions of this game over the years, and even though the newer version has cool plastic minis, when I was thinking about offloading my 1st edition in favor of the 3rd edition, I couldn't bring myself to do it. The iconography is better in 1st version and the rules tweaks in the later versions don't really add anything (Hidden gems of various values help prevent some of "gang up on the leader" syndrome, but also some of the fun). I'll hang onto my 1st edition, thanks.

Wargames are never really "finished" since customer playtesting and developments in the hobby frequently spark improvements in existing designs. Of course, quite a number of New & Improved (tm) versions are mangled during the process instead of polished... but that is another issue.
